The video coding standard is developed rapidly, and the newest 2 standards are AVS which is proposed by Chinese and China owned the knowledge property right, and H.264/AVC which is the most popular standard around the world. They both began to adopt a new Transform Coding method, which is called Integer Cosine Transform (ICT). And the original method DCT is replaced. Compared to DCT, ICT has the similar compress performance, only need integer calculation, has low complexity for hardware implementation and no miss matching problem between the encoder and decoder. Since ICT has so many advantages, it will be applied to more and more applications.On the other hand, although the high video quality is demanded, the transport band is limited. In this condition, we need an appropriate and good Bit Allocation method to achieve better visual quality when the Bit Rate is constrained. There's a new Bit Allocation method based on HVS which allocates more bits to the areas that catches more attention from human's eyes and allocates less bits to the areas that people will not be interested in.
